Dual Diagnosis Treatment

A dual diagnosis presents a complex challenge, requiring integrated treatment approaches that tackle both substance use disorder and underlying mental health conditions. It's crucial to recognize that these two challenges often intersect each other, creating a vicious cycle. Effective dual diagnosis treatment targets rebuilding overall well-being by integrating therapies tailored to each individual's needs. Options may involve a variety of strategies,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y, dialectical behavior therapy, supportive counseling.
